AI Readiness In North American Automotive

AI Readiness in North American Automotive refers to the preparedness and capability of automotive companies to integrate artificial intelligence into their operations and offerings. This concept encompasses the technological infrastructure, workforce skills, and strategic vision necessary for leveraging AI effectively. As AI emerges as a transformative force across various sectors, its relevance to the automotive sector is heightened, compelling stakeholders to adapt to evolving consumer demands and operational efficiencies. In the evolving landscape of the automotive sector, AI readiness is pivotal for enhancing competitive advantage and fostering innovation. AI-driven practices are not only redefining traditional business models but also reshaping how stakeholders interact and collaborate. The integration of AI can significantly improve efficiency and decision-making processes, steering companies toward long-term strategic goals. However, while the potential for growth is substantial, companies must navigate challenges such as integration complexity, adoption barriers, and shifting market expectations to fully realize the benefits of AI.
